Chapter 194 She Can't Wait to Move in

After Phoebe swallowed her medicine, her face turned pale from bitterness.

She almost retched several times, but held it back, not wanting to give the two onlookers any satisfaction.

She took a frying pan out and placed it on the stove, then fetched a steak, broccoli, eggs, and butter from the refrigerator.

The kitchen was semi-open, and as Phoebe began to cook the steak on one side, Theodore was applying ice on Vanessa on the other side near the fridge.

When Phoebe entered, Theodore withdrew his hand, leaving Vanessa to apply the ice herself. He leaned against the sink, silent.

The atmosphere was awkward, but no one left the kitchen, as if leaving first would mean admitting defeat.

As the oil heated up, Phoebe put the steak in the pan. The oil sizzled as it hit the water, and the aroma of the meat began to fill the room. Phoebe skillfully cooked the steak while blanching the broccoli in boiling water. In less than ten minutes, dinner was ready.
